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the warning signs of attic water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age to your property. Here are some common signs that you need attic water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ors in your attic can be a sign of mold growth, which can be hazardous to your health.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s essential to call a professional to assess the situation.
Water Stains or Warping on Ceiling or Walls
Water stains or warping on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age in your attic. This can lead to costly repairs if left unchecked.
Increased Energy Bills
If you notice a sudden increase in your energy bills, it may be a sign that your attic insulation has been compromised due to water damage. This can lead to heat loss and increased energy costs.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ots, mineral deposits, or warping, can be a clear indication that you need attic water damage restoration.
Unpleasant Odors or Humidity in Living Areas
If you notice unpleasant odors or high humidity in your living areas, it may be a sign that water damage in your attic is affecting your home’s air quality.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ible signs of mold or mildew in your attic can be a health risk and need immediate attention. Our team will work to remove the mold and mildew and prevent future growth.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ost in Flowery Branch, GA
The cost of attic water damage restoration var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Flowery Branch, GA. Here’s a breakdown of the typical costs associated with our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water, size of the affected area, and type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of the drying process |
| Anti-Microbial Treatments |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the mold growth, size of the affected area, and type of treatment needed |
| Materials and Equipment | $1,000 – $5,000 | The type and quality of materials and equipment needed to restore your attic |
The exact cost of attic water damage restoration will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an to restore your attic to its original state.

Common Questions About Attic Water Damage Restoration
Q: How long does attic water damage restoration take?
A: The time it takes to restore your attic to its original state depends on the severity and size of the affected area. But, we typically complete the process within 3-5 days.
Q: What causes attic water damage?
A: Attic water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including roof leaks, overflowing gutters, and condensation. Our team will work with you to identify the source of the damage and create a customized plan to prevent future occurrences.
Q: Can I DIY attic water damage restoration?
A: While you may be able to fix small leaks or clean up minor water damage yourself, ignoring the warning signs of attic water dam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ks. It’s essential to call a professional to ensure your attic is safe and dry.
Q: Will my insurance company cover the costs of attic water damage restoration?
A: We’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. But, the extent of coverage will depend on your policy and the circumstances surrounding the damage.
